In order to keep our relationships strong, it's vital to spend time, energy, and attention on them. We're all so busy, and we have to be intentional about carving out time for people that we don't see by default every day.
If you live your life on autopilot, just focused on making it through another day, you can wake up decades later and regret all the time you missed.

There is just something about being in person, face to face with another human that cannot quite be replicated with all our fancy video call technology. It's still a great tool for long distance, to be clear! But having close, local connections is necessary.
If making new friends seems overwhelming, I get it. It is hard! So instead, let's start small this week.
Send a quick message to someone you haven't talked to in a while (email and text are fine for this!). Even if it's been years of radio silence, I bet they'll be thrilled you reached out.
Set up a phone call or coffee date to catch up with someone local.
Write a "thinking of you" or "just for fun" card & mail it.
Smile at a stranger.
Give a compliment to someone at the store.
Send your love and care out into the world, and it will come back to you. Giving it away can make you feel better even on the worst of days.
